MAP09: Exquisite Guilt is the ninth map of 100LineN. It was designed by Darryl Steffen (dobu gabu maru) and uses the music track "".

Essentials[edit]

As the level starts you will see a Hell knight (baron of Hell on Ultra-Violence (UV) and Nightmare (NM) skill levels) in front of you, and there will be one or two demons behind you that can trap you when you make a noise. Press the door that the noble is guarding to lower the floor, deal with the lost souls and mancubus then head east to see one or two revenants guarding a lift. Activate the lift, which has an arch-vile hiding behind it on Hurt Me Plenty (HMP) or higher, then ride the lift up and follow the ledge back to the starting room where a doorway has opened in the north-west wall.

Press the skull switch behind the doorway to activate a second lift, ride it up to a platform with a rocket launcher then straferun to the platform below which holds the red skull key; landing on the platform will release various monsters, including a pain elemental, near the first lift. Go back to that lift and open the red door behind it to enter a blood pool, then flip the skull lever on the north-west wall to release imps and revenants (plus an arch-vile on HMP or higher). Press the satyr switch at the south-east end to lower the center column and reveal a berserk pack, then collect this item to finish the level.

Secrets[edit]

  1. Go behind the red key platform to find a supercharge (or an armor and two stimpacks on UV and NM). (sector 16)

Bugs[edit]

Two monster pairs (things 65 and 205, 71 and 204) are each meant to have only one monster enabled depending on difficulty, but they all spawn and are stuck on the easy difficulties.
